Chapter context: The Virtue of al-Hasan and al-Husain, the two sons of `Ali ibn Abi Talib (raa)

باب فَضْلِ الْحَسَنِ وَالْحُسَيْنِ ابْنَىْ عَلِيِّ بْنِ أَبِي طَالِبٍ رضى الله عنهم

View in chapter

Hadith text

Original Arabic

حَدَّثَنَا عَلِيُّ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، حَدَّثَنَا وَكِيعٌ، عَنْ سُفْيَانَ، عَنْ دَاوُدَ بْنِ أَبِي عَوْفٍ أَبِي الْجَحَّافِ، - وَكَانَ مَرْضِيًّا - عَنْ أَبِي حَازِمٍ، ع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، قَالَ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 ـ صلى الله عليه وسلم ـ ‏

‏ مَنْ أَحَبَّ الْحَسَنَ وَالْحُسَيْنَ فَقَدْ أَحَبَّنِي وَمَنْ أَبْغَضَهُمَا فَقَدْ أَبْغَضَنِي ‏

‏ ‏.‏

Translation

English translation

It was narrated that Abu Hurairah said:

"The Messenger of Allah said: 'Whoever loves Hasan and Husain, loves me; and whoever hates them, hates me.'"
